Simba Slots Welcome Offer – The Safari Chest
New players who fund an account with £10 or more get to open the Safari Chest, which can award up to 500 free spins on Starburst. No casino codes are required. The prize is determined when the chest is opened, so the advertised 500 spins is the top outcome rather than a guaranteed one. Bonus cash carries a 10x wagering requirement, and conversion to real funds is capped at the value of your lifetime deposits, up to a maximum of £250. That cap is the single most important term on the page: it means a new player with one £10 deposit can convert no more than £10 from bonus winnings, regardless of what the chest awards.
Daily Wheel
The Daily Wheel gives every player one free spin per day, with a chance of winning free spins. Each spin is available within a rolling 24-hour window shown in the daily spins tab, and it costs nothing to take, requiring no deposit or code at the point of spinning. Missing a day simply means missing that spin, as they do not accumulate. It is the lowest-commitment thing on the site and, for players logging in regularly anyway, effectively free upside subject to the standard conversion cap.
Drops & Wins 2026
Drops & Wins is a Pragmatic Play network campaign, meaning the £25,000,000 prize pool is shared across every participating casino rather than being exclusive to Simba Slots. It runs from March 2026 to March 2027, divided into stages, each with its own opt-in window accessed through the in-game pop-up or the Join Now button in the Tournaments category. Qualifying spins on eligible games can trigger random cash prize drops, while separate leaderboards award further prizes. Because the eligible game list and opt-in dates change with each stage, checking the Tournaments section before you play is the practical step here.
Fluffy Fridays
Fluffy Fridays is a three-hour weekly tournament running Friday evenings from 8pm to 11pm, with a £250 pool split among the top players. Every wager on a qualifying game during the window earns an entry, and with no minimum bet applied, small-stakes players accumulate entries just as steadily as anyone else. The tight window is the catch: outside 8pm to 11pm on a Friday, the promotion simply isn’t running, so it rewards timing rather than volume.
About Simba Slots
Simba Slots runs on the Jumpman Gaming platform, licensed by the UK Gambling Commission, and shares its promotional architecture with a number of sister sites, which is why the Daily Wheel, Drops & Wins, and Fluffy Fridays will look familiar to anyone who has played across the group. What Simba Slots does have is a lighter set of terms than it once carried: wagering on bonus cash now sits at 10x, down considerably from the 65x that applied under earlier promotions, and that puts it below the UK average. The structural quirk that defines the site remains the conversion cap, limiting real-money withdrawals from bonus winnings to your lifetime deposit total up to £250, which effectively ties the value of any bonus to how much you have put in. Bonus funds and free spins are playable across a wide bonus-enabled games list running from Big Bass Splash to Gates of Olympus.
Responsible Gambling
When playing at Simba Slots, the conversion cap deserves particular thought, because it links what you can withdraw from a bonus directly to what you have deposited over your lifetime on the site. That is a structure which can quietly encourage depositing more to unlock more, and recognising the incentive is the best defence against it. Decide your budget before you open the chest, not after. Setting deposit and session limits in your account makes that concrete. Simba Slots Bonus Codes FAQ
Does Simba Slots require a bonus code?
No. None of the current Simba Slots offers use a code. The Safari Chest opens automatically on a qualifying first deposit, and the Daily Wheel, Drops & Wins, and Fluffy Fridays are joined through the account, an in-game pop-up, or simply by playing during the promotional window.
What is the Simba Slots welcome offer?
New players funding with £10 or more open the Safari Chest, which can award up to 500 free spins on Starburst. The prize varies by opening. Bonus cash carries a 10x wagering requirement and conversion to real funds is capped at your lifetime deposits, up to £250.
What are the Simba Slots wagering requirements?
Bonus cash carries a 10x wagering requirement, well below the UK average. The more restrictive term is the conversion cap, which limits how much of your bonus winnings can become withdrawable cash to the value of your lifetime deposits, to a ceiling of £250.
What is the maximum I can win from a Simba Slots bonus?
Real-money conversion from bonus winnings is capped at your lifetime deposits, up to a maximum of £250. So a player who has deposited £40 in total can convert at most £40, while £250 is the absolute ceiling no matter how much has been deposited.
